Signalling fault causes morning disruption between Richmond and Willesden Junction
By Nub News Reporter 3rd Mar 2026
Passengers faced disruption on the London Underground this morning after a signalling fault affected services between Richmond and Willesden Junction.
The incident, which was reported at 7am today (Tuesday, 3 March), impacted trains running on the line between Stratford and Richmond.
According to National Rail, the disruption was caused by a fault with the signalling system between Gunnersbury and Richmond.
Services were subject to alterations while the issue was dealt with.
The fault was cleared at 8:59am, and trains are now running as normal between Willesden Junction and Richmond.
Commuters are advised to check before they travel for the latest service updates.
